Converts IsMashEnabled() to IsAshInProcess()
And adds OopAsh for the new code path.
BUG=837686
TEST=covered by tests
Cq-Include-Trybots: luci.chromium.try:android_optional_gpu_tests_rel;luci.chromium.try:linux_optional_gpu_tests_rel;luci.chromium.try:mac_optional_gpu_tests_rel;luci.chromium.try:win_optional_gpu_tests_rel
Change-Id: I5e0dbaccd8974ecf996e7507f0e327fc37c281db
Reviewed-on: https://chromium-review.googlesource.com/1101648
Commit-Queue: Scott Violet <[email protected]>
Reviewed-by: Tom Sepez <[email protected]>
Reviewed-by: James Cook <[email protected]>
Cr-Commit-Position: refs/heads/master@{#567682}
diff --git a/content/renderer/render_widget.cc b/content/renderer/render_widget.cc
index 25eda55..d865edf 100644
--- a/content/renderer/render_widget.cc
+++ b/content/renderer/render_widget.cc
@@ -426,7 +426,7 @@
}
#if defined(USE_AURA)
RendererWindowTreeClient::CreateIfNecessary(routing_id_);
- if (features::IsMashEnabled())
+ if (!features::IsAshInBrowserProcess())
RendererWindowTreeClient::Get(routing_id_)->SetVisible(!is_hidden_);
#endif
}
@@ -2041,7 +2041,7 @@
is_hidden_ = hidden;
#if defined(USE_AURA)
- if (features::IsMashEnabled())
+ if (!features::IsAshInBrowserProcess())
RendererWindowTreeClient::Get(routing_id_)->SetVisible(!hidden);
#endif